Pixelates areas inside videos with opencv

#!/usr/bin/env python2 | |
# encoding: utf-8 | |
import cv2 | |
import cv | |
import sys | |
video = cv2.VideoCapture("input.webm") | |
fps = video.get(cv.CV_CAP_PROP_FPS) / 2 | |
videoout = cv2.VideoWriter() | |
size = (int(video.get(cv.CV_CAP_PROP_FRAME_WIDTH)), int(video.get(cv.CV_CAP_PROP_FRAME_HEIGHT))) | |
fourcc = int(video.get(cv.CV_CAP_PROP_FOURCC)) | |
fourcc = fourcc or cv.CV_FOURCC('V', 'P', '8', '0') | |
videoout.open("blured.webm", fourcc, 15 or video.get(cv.CV_CAP_PROP_FPS), size) | |
if not videoout.isOpened(): | |
print "Error write. VideoWrite/ffmpeg support missing?" | |
exit(1) | |
blurs = [ | |
# [start_frame, end_frame, (pos_left, pos_top), (pos_right, pos_bottum)] | |
[15, 65, (1500, 180), (2310, 475)], | |
[265, 310, (1500, 180), (2800, 1600)], | |
] | |
i = 0 | |
while True: | |
ret, img = video.read() | |
i += 1 | |
if not ret: | |
break | |
sys.stdout.write("\r{}".format(i)) | |
sys.stdout.flush() | |
for b in blurs: | |
if b[0] <= i <= b[1]: | |
roi = img[b[2][1]:b[3][1],b[2][0]:b[3][0]] | |
roi = cv2.GaussianBlur(roi, (33,33), 3) | |
#img = roi | |
img[b[2][1]:b[3][1],b[2][0]:b[3][0]] = roi | |
# cv2.imshow("preview", img) | |
videoout.write(img) | |
# if cv2.waitKey(int(1000/fps)) & 0xff == 27: | |
# print i | |
# break |
